Important Dates for CM Punjab Veterinary Internship 2025
Feature | Details |
Program Name | CM Punjab Veterinary Internship 2025 |
Monthly Stipend | Rs.60,000 (for DVM graduates) / Rs.40,000 (for para-vets & assistants) |
Duration | 12 months (extendable based on performance) |
Total Budget | Rs.600 million |
Seats | 1,000 across all 36 districts of Punjab |
Eligibility Criteria
- Applicant must be a graduate in Veterinary Sciences (DVM) from a recognized university in Pakistan.
- Fresh graduates or those awaiting results are encouraged to apply.
- Preference may be given to candidates belonging to Punjab.
- Applicants should be under the age of 30 years at the time of application.
- Candidates must have a valid PMDC/PEC or equivalent veterinary registration.

Why Was the CM Punjab Veterinary Internship Launched?
Punjab’s economy depends heavily on agriculture and livestock. Despite thousands of veterinary graduates produced each year, many lack practical exposure to real-life field challenges. The internship was launched to:
- Equip fresh graduates with hands-on veterinary training.
- Improve animal health services across Punjab.
- Create employment opportunities and financial relief for young professionals.
- Strengthen Pakistan’s livestock exports through skilled manpower.
